Ellipse Alaska Ellipse Alaska
The new Ellipse Alaska, which joins the Ellipse Titanium, Ellipse and Ellipse Octopus, completes the Ellipse range of regulators.
This model has been designed mainly for use in cold water.
The MC7 diaphragm first stage comes with the standard issue antifreeze kit and the second stage is identical to the one used in the Ellipse Titanium.

The first stage of the Ellipse Alaska is the already famous and excellent Cressi MC7 model balanced diaphragm. It comes with the antifreeze kit, which provides an additional waterproof chamber, to screw onto the end of the first stage. This chamber ends with a silicon diaphragm on the outside that seals off the inside from contact with water, while still transmitting any pressure variation to the inner organs, thanks to the flexibility of the material.
The antifreeze kit is composed of two main parts, both made from strong chrome-plated brass. There is a mushroom element inside, made from acetylic resin, which connects the external diaphragm to the internal one.

The use of the antifreeze kit completely eliminates any water seepage into the external part of the first stage, so not only does it prevent the formation of ice in this area, but it also prevents the formation of deposits and incrustations on the diaphragm and on the spring. This provides considerable advantages for divers working in mineral-rich water or with lots of suspension (archaeological sites, port works, caving etc...)

AIRTECH AIRTECH
In the range of Cressi regulators, Airtech is the top of the line model. It comes with traditionally sized 2nd stage casing and takes advantage of all the most modern technology to offer the best in all situations. The downstream regulating system has a very light piston made from hi-tech polymers, pneumatically balanced, which guarantees constant performance, irrespective of the depth or the pressure in the tank.

The 2nd stage has a dual adjustment system: an upper deviator that acts on the Venturi effect and a side knob to regulate inhalation effort. The size of the 2nd stage has no effect on the weight, which is very light because of the use of special hi-tech polymers and titanium inserts.

1st stage
Airtech comes with both the MC7 hyper-balanced diaphragm or the AC10 piston balanced 1st stage; their performance is very similar so it is up to the user to choose the system they prefer.
The MC7 balanced diaphragm 1st stage boasts very high performance, while being easy to maintain and very strong. The “in line” configuration with the air outlet from the tank guarantees very high performance, reducing drops in pressure to a minimum. The MC7 first stage is hyper-balanced, guaranteeing a rise in the intermediate pressure when the air supply in the tank begins to drop. So the regulator provides maximum performance in the final stage of the dive, notoriously the most critical.

The MC7 model can be supplied with an antifreeze kit, which completely seals the diaphragm from contact with the water, making it suitable for use even in extreme conditions.

It comes in the 3 versions: INT, DIN 200 bar and DIN 300 bar.
AC10 piston-balanced first stage is the latest version of the Cressi piston balanced model, produced for many years and highly appreciated due to its excellent characteristics of strength and simplicity. Over the years it has undergone a constant evolution combined with a considerable increase in performance. The AC10 version comes with a revolving turret with some 5 low pressure outlets, a sintered filter and the really handy Cressi system for external calibration of the intermediate pressure.
It comes in the 3 versions: INT, DIN 200 bar and DIN 300 bar.

Octopus Ellipse Octopus Ellipse
Octopus Ellipse uses the same casing as the Ellipse model made from special hi-tech polymers, the only difference being the yellow front cover. The hose is also yellow and is longer (100 cm against the standard 76 cm).

All the parts of Ellipse, most of which are patented, can be found on this regulator: the fold-out opening of the casing, the special folding diaphragm, the computer designed lever, the tilting movement of the piston, the seal between regulator valve and casing, the possibility of extracting the entire valve system from the body of the 2nd stage.
A flow of pilot air is channelled to the mouthpiece by injection, enhancing the performance.

The upper part of the body has a flow deviator that acts on the Venturi effect, with dive/pre-dive function.

The performance is extremely high, although the calibration is regulated so that the inhalation effort is slightly greater than on the Ellipse, to prevent any self-regulating possibility when it is used as a spare regulator. Octopus Ellipse suits all the Cressi first stages perfectly and all the first stages with an intermediate pressure between 9 and 10 bar.

Ellipse 2nd stage
Calibration pressure 9-10 bar
Average inhale effort (*) 8 mbar
Average exhale effort (*) 11 mbar
Average breathing work (*) 1.3 J/l
Air supply 1300 l/m
Weight (without hose) 166 g
(*)values measured in compliance with UNI EN 250 standards.
